Japanese martial artist
Daiki Hata (Japanese : 畑 大樹 , Hata Daiki , born August 24, 1982) is a Japanese professional mixed martial artist and the former DEEP Bantamweight Champion. He is also an occasional kickboxer .
Mixed martial arts career
Japanese career
Daiki began his professional MMA career in July 2004 for the Pancrase promotion. Over the next four years, he amassed a record of 8 wins, 5 losses and 1 draw primarily in that promotion. During this time he had a victory over WEC contenders Kenji Osawa .
In August 2008, Daiki began fighting for the DEEP promotion. Over the next few years he would also fight for DREAM , K-1 , Cage Force , and S-Cup .

Road to UFC: Japan
In June 2015, Hata was announced as one of the eight featherweights competing on Road to UFC: Japan , a show in the style of The Ultimate Fighter . He defeated Tatsunao Nagakura in the quarterfinals. In the semifinals, he lost to Mizuto Hirota by decision.
Rizin Fighting Federation
In his debut for the Rizin Fighting Federation , Hata faced Hiroyuki Takaya on December 29, 2015. He lost the fight via unanimous decision.
Return to DEEP
After the one-fight stint in Rizin FF, Hata returned to DEEP to face Yuki Motoya at DEEP Cage Impact 2016 on October 18, 2016. He lost the fight via unanimous decision.[ 2]
Hata then went on to lose against Takahiro Ashida before defeating Kyosuke Yokoyama and Koichi Ishizuka consecutively, earning him a title shot. Hata challenged Satoshi Yamasu for the DEEP Featherweight Championship at DEEP 89 on May 12, 2019. He lost the bout via second-round technical knockout.[ 3]
Hata then faced Kouya Kanda at DEEP 100 on February 21, 2021.[ 4] He lost the fight via unanimous decision.[ 5]
Hata faced Tetsuya Seki at DEEP 103 on September 23, 2021.[ 6] He won the bout via unanimous decision.[ 7]
Hata faced Kosuke Terashima at DEEP 107 on MAy 8, 2022 for the Interim DEEP Bantamweight Championship . He lost the bout via unanimous decision.[ 8]
Hata faced Jinnosuke Kashimura on March 25, 2023 at DEEP Tokyo Impact 2023 2nd Round, winning the bout via unanimous decision.[ 9]
